What companies run services between Rotterdam, Netherlands and Roden, Drenthe, Netherlands?
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S) operates a train from Rotterdam Centraal to Groningen every 4 hours. Tickets cost €27–65 and the journey takes 2h 37m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Rotterdam Central Station to Groningen central station twice daily. Tickets cost €18–35 and the journey takes 3h 45m.
